William G. Cole is a scholar working on Genetics, Rheumatology and Surgery. According to data from OpenAlex, William G. Cole has authored 218 papers receiving a total of 9.3k indexed citations (citations by other indexed papers that have themselves been cited), including 90 papers in Genetics, 67 papers in Rheumatology and 56 papers in Surgery. Recurrent topics in William G. Cole’s work include Connective tissue disorders research (84 papers), Cell Adhesion Molecules Research (31 papers) and Bone fractures and treatments (23 papers). William G. Cole is often cited by papers focused on Connective tissue disorders research (84 papers), Cell Adhesion Molecules Research (31 papers) and Bone fractures and treatments (23 papers). William G. Cole collaborates with scholars based in Canada, Australia and United States. William G. Cole's co-authors include Danny Chan, John F. Bateman, Bernhard Zabel, Outi Mäkitie, Stefan Mundlos, Shireen R. Lamandé, Bjørn R. Olsen, Roland Mertelsmann, Wolfram Henn and F Otto and has published in prestigious journals such as Nature, Cell and New England Journal of Medicine.
